1. Anatomy of Drama: How Reality TV and Games Use the Same Storytelling Tools

Beat structures and escalation

Both reality TV and narrative games rely on beats: set‑ups, escalations, peaks, and payoffs. Production teams in television engineer these beats through editing and reveal timing; developers do it through mission design and scripting. The language differs, but the effect—building expectation and then delivering surprise—is the same. Conflict as currency

Conflict drives attention. In The Traitors, interpersonal conflict and resource scarcity create constant micro‑stakes; in games, mechanics create conflict through limited supplies, timers, or asymmetric information. Both formats monetize tension: reality shows through ad-spots and ratings, games through retention, DLC, or streaming viewership. Familiar story arcs

Hero's journeys, betrayals, underdog rises—these archetypes are reused because they're effective. Reality producers cast archetypal players and amplify traits in edit; game designers lean on player archetypes and emergent narratives. This cross-pollination is deliberate: producers study player behavior and games study TV editing to keep audiences invested.

2. Mechanics of Tension: Pacing, Reveal, and Player/Viewer Agency

Pacing through interaction design

Pacing in TV is primarily editorial. In games, designers must build pacing into systems: encounter density, save points, information drops, and branching choices. Information asymmetry and dramatic irony

Dramatic irony—when the audience knows more than a character—is a staple in reality TV and a powerful lever in games. Designers can introduce asymmetric knowledge with hidden agendas, fog-of-war, or delayed narrative reveals. The result is heightened engagement because viewers or other players mentally simulate outcomes and anticipate reactions.

Branching reveals and spoiler management

When you enable branching narratives you must manage spoilers and pacing across multiple playthroughs. The solution combines technical tools (branch tracking, modular story assets) and editorial strategies (seeding surprises without destroying future payoffs). 3. Characters, Casting, and Players: Emotional Investment and Social Dynamics

Casting players vs. creating characters

Reality TV invests heavily in casting because real people with strong, readable personalities create drama. Games cast too—through character classes, archetypal backstories, and social systems that encourage identity projection. Creating moments where players can reveal character under stress is a universal design tactic: it humanizes and heightens stakes.

Parasocial relationships and fandom

Both formats foster parasocial bonds—audiences form one-sided relationships with contestants, streamers, or characters. That bond fuels repeat engagement and community conversation. Social mechanics that create drama

Designers can embed social friction in systems: voting mechanics, trade-offs, teammate incentives, and asymmetric goals. These systems create emergent narratives that feel authentic because they're player-driven rather than writer-forced.

4. Production Choices: Editing, Sound, and Visuals that Manufacture Drama

Editing as storytelling

Editing in reality TV shapes viewer perception—cutting can villainize or humanize moments. Games emulate this with in-engine cutscenes, camera framing, and real-time event sequencing. Sound design: the unseen director

Sound is the backbone of perceived tension. A well-placed sting, silence, or ambient cue can change how a scene reads. Music supervisors in TV use leitmotifs to signal character shifts; game audio similarly layers dynamic scores and stingers to cue player behavior and expectation.

Visual affordances and spectacle

Visual markers—set dressing, HUD changes, lighting—guide attention. Reality sets use confessional shots and tight close-ups; games use camera pulls, VFX, and HUD flips to turn mechanical moments into cinematic spectacle. 7. Practical Playbook: Designing Dramatic Experiences for Games

Step 1 — Prototype the beat

Start with a beat prototype: a 2–3 minute interaction that contains a clear setup, twist, and payoff. Use mock audio and camera cues, then test for emotional response. Techniques from drama education—covered in our scripting success guide—work for rapid iteration in game dev too.

Step 2 — Embed asymmetric stakes

Add stakes that matter differently to different players: a public leaderboard, a hidden reward, or a social sanction. Such asymmetry sparks social drama and keeps content socially sharable. Step 3 — Harden safety and moderation

Plan moderation for dramatic systems. Paradoxically, the most dramatic systems need the most guardrails—clear conduct rules, content filters, and escalation paths. 8. Metrics: Measuring Dramatic Experiences and Player Engagement

Behavioral KPIs that matter

Beyond DAU/MAU and watch-time, measure micro-engagements: clip frequency, share rates, retention after major reveals, and average session length following a narrative beat. Engagement spikes around key events are the modern ratings. 9. Case Study: The Traitors vs. A Modern Narrative Game

Premise and mechanics

The Traitors creates dramaturgy through hidden roles, limited information, and structured rituals (banishment, missions, confessionals). Compare that to a modern social-deduction game where players assume identities, form alliances, and vote; mechanics map almost one-to-one. Producers and designers can learn from each other's iteration cycles.

Pacing and tension points

The show's ceremonies (e.g., morning reveals) act like scripted beats that punctuate a week. Games implement the same with timed events, raids, or seasonal story acts. What each medium should steal from the other

Reality TV should borrow systems thinking from games for fairness and replayability; games should adopt TV's editorial discipline for emotional clarity. 10. Reality TV vs Games — A Practical Comparison Table

Below is a side-by-side comparison to help teams spot where techniques are interchangeable and where medium-specific constraints apply.

Dimension Reality TV Games
Primary Driver Human behavior and edit Mechanics and player agency
Pacing Control Editorial (edit takes) Design systems (timers, events)
Replayability Low (same footage), high via recuts High (branching, multiplayer)
Ethical Risks Participant harm via edit Privacy, doxxing, deepfakes
Technical Constraints Production budgets, shoot logistics Hardware, netcode, storage
Best For Emotional, human story arcs Interactive, replay-driven narratives

How can small indie teams create big dramatic moments?

Focus on one or two beats and iterate. Use limited scope but high emotional clarity—tight writing, a single compelling moral choice, and a small cast.
